Franklin Elementary School (Closed 2004)

1011 S Main St
Rice Lake, WI 54868
Franklin Elementary School serves 98 students in grades Prekindergarten-5. 
Minority enrollment was 5%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which was lower than the Wisconsin state average of 33% (majority Hispanic).

Frequently Asked Questions

How many students attend Franklin Elementary School?
98 students attend Franklin Elementary School.
What is the racial composition of the student body?
95% of Franklin Elementary School students are White, 3% of students are Hispanic, 1% of students are Asian, and 1% of students are Black.
What grades does Franklin Elementary School offer ?
Franklin Elementary School offers enrollment in grades Prekindergarten-5
What school district is Franklin Elementary School part of?
Franklin Elementary School is part of Rice Lake Area School District.
